Context: Zhongji Xuchuang is the world’s largest supplier of high-speed optical modules for data centers. Their 800G products are the gold standard for connecting NVIDIA’s GB200 superclusters. Without them, training large language models would grind to a halt. The company’s technology is not about blockchain directly, but it underpins every major cloud provider—Google, Microsoft, Amazon—that also hosts blockchain nodes. The IPO, rumored to be around 70 billion yuan (approximately $9 billion), is one of the largest for a semiconductor-related firm this decade, with cornerstone investors including Temasek, Hillhouse, BlackRock, and UBS. The narrative is simple: AI demand is exploding, and the winners are those who build the physical pipes. But the deeper narrative is about centralization. The same infrastructure that powers decentralized networks is being built by a single company in China, relying on a fragile supply chain of InP substrates, Japanese testing equipment, and US-made DSP chips. Code is law, but humans are the protocol. And the protocol right now is a single point of failure. Core analysis: The technology itself is fascinating. 800G modules use 8 channels of 100G PAM4 modulation, requiring precise pairing of EML lasers and silicon photonics. The next step is 1.6T, expected within two years, followed by co-packaged optics (CPO) that merge the optical engine directly onto the switch ASIC. This is where blockchain’s decentralization philosophy meets a hard physical reality. To achieve sub-millisecond latency for a global validator set, you need optical interconnects. But the production of these interconnects is concentrated. Zhongji Xuchuang commands 25–35% of the 800G market. Their closest rival, Coherent, has a similar share. The top two companies control over half the supply. This is not a decentralized landscape. The common narrative is that this IPO is a massive vote of confidence in AI infrastructure. And it is. But let me challenge that with a pragmatic test. The research report I read stated a massive 70-billion-dollar figure for the IPO. That’s an order of magnitude too high. After cross-referencing with the company’s A-share market cap (about 150 billion yuan) and revenue (about 10 billion yuan annually), the realistic fundraising is around 70 billion yuan, not dollars. This discrepancy tells me something: the hype is inflated. The market wants to believe in a superhero story. But the reality is that Zhongji Xuchuang faces significant risks. Their top five customers account for over 70% of revenue, and those customers are increasingly designing their own optical modules. Google, Microsoft, and Meta have all invested in internal photonics teams. If one of them switches to in-house production, the IPO thesis cracks. Furthermore, the reliance on US-made DSP chips (from Broadcom and Marvell) exposes the company to export controls. A single executive order could block those chips, and while Chinese alternatives are emerging, they are still 12–18 months behind in performance. The contrarian truth is that this IPO is not just a fundraising event; it’s an insurance policy against a future that may not be as bright as the prospectus suggests.
